Many Southern Californians have been faced with foreclosure during the
recent collapse of the housing market. In San Diego County, average home
and condo values have been reduced by 40% to 50% in the last 5 years.
Many homeowners are struggling with multiple mortgages and zero home equity,
and are working hard to stay afloat and pay what they owe — all
the while worrying about the future of their homes and families.
